Do You Want to Maximize Your Returns? Buy This Low-Risk, High-Yield Dividend Stock.

Core Viewpoint - Realty Income is positioned to maximize investor returns through a combination of high-yield dividends and solid growth prospects, making it an attractive investment option [2][14]. Dividend Performance - Realty Income has declared 660 consecutive monthly dividends and increased its dividend payment 131 times since its public listing in 1994, showcasing a strong commitment to returning capital to shareholders [4]. - The REIT has maintained a streak of 111 straight quarters and 30 consecutive years of dividend increases, with a compound annual growth rate of 4.2% in its payout during this period [4]. Financial Stability - Realty Income currently offers a dividend yield of 5.6%, supported by a stable income generated from a diversified portfolio of high-quality real estate, including retail, industrial, and gaming properties [5]. - The REIT conservatively pays out 75% of its adjusted funds from operations (FFO) in dividends, allowing it to retain excess cash flow for new investments [6]. Growth Consistency - Since its public market listing, Realty Income has delivered positive adjusted FFO per share growth every year except for 2009, demonstrating resilience through various economic conditions [8]. - The company has achieved a 5% compound annual FFO growth from 1996 to 2008 and 5.4% from 2009 to 2022, indicating its ability to grow even during periods of economic stress [9]. Market Potential - The total addressable market for net lease real estate in the U.S. and Europe is estimated at $14 billion, providing Realty Income with significant long-term growth potential [12]. - The REIT is expected to continue growing its adjusted FFO per share at a mid-single-digit annual rate over the long term [12]. Valuation Comparison - Realty Income trades at approximately 13 times its adjusted FFO, which is below the 18x average of other REITs in the S&P 500, indicating a compelling valuation [13]. - Despite trading at a discount to its peers, Realty Income has consistently delivered a higher operational return, averaging 9.7% over the past five years compared to 7.7% for its peers [13].
